City Vision University

Kansas City, MO

Our 2023 rankings named City Vision University the most popular online school in Missouri for mental and social health services students working on their bachelor’s degree. City Vision University is a small private not-for-profit school located in the city of Kansas City.

Women make up 71% of the mental health services majors at the school.

The average amount in student loans that mental health services majors at City Vision University take out while working on their Bachelor's Degree is $17,674.
